Output 0c185907c723f125fb2eb03d77aaeee9c4c6a39c3faf5a7be96feda80bfda024:10

value
28227145
script pubkey
OP_0 OP_PUSHBYTES_20 fdbfb9b3e1b31f4373d4e95d6f8c19a2384e879a
address
ltc1qlklmnvlpkv05xu75a9wklrqe5guyapu6cupuwk
transaction
0c185907c723f125fb2eb03d77aaeee9c4c6a39c3faf5a7be96feda80bfda024
spent
true